Denver Deploys PermitFlow AI to Process 73% of Residential Permits
Content
The City of Denver has deployed PermitFlow AI, a document understanding engine fine-tuned on Denver municipal code, to process 73% of residential permit applications with sub-90-second turnaround times. The system uses a fine-tuned Llama 3 70B base model augmented with RAG pipeline pulling from official building code API and geospatial zoning layers. YOLOv8 object detection extracts structural elements from site plans before feeding into the LLM for code compliance reasoning. Median end-to-end processing takes 1.8 seconds per application on NVIDIA L40S GPU. The system achieves 89.4% F1-score on variance detection tasks, outperforming legacy rule-based engines by 22 points in blind audits. When Denver updated its ADU ordinance in March 2026, the system required only 4 hours of retraining versus 200+ hours for traditional platforms.
